Herzlich Willkommen, lieber Gast!
  Sie befinden sich hier:

  Forum » Software » SQL in MS Access

Forum | Hilfe | Team | Links | Impressum | > Suche < | Mitglieder | Registrieren | Einloggen
  Quicklinks: MSDN-Online || STL || clib Reference Grundlagen || Literatur || E-Books || Zubehör || > F.A.Q. < || Downloads   

Autor Thread - Seiten: > 1 <
000
06.05.2008, 16:18 Uhr
Heiko



Hey Leute,

wusste nicht wos hin passt deswegen Poste ich es hier.

Also ich hab folgendes Problem.
Ich habe in Access eine Tabelle und will über eine Abfrage 10 Einträge abfragen. Die Kriterien spielen an der stelle keine Rolle da die sich auch ab und an ändern.

Will also die Top 10 nach einem bestimmten kriterium.

Wenn ich mit PHP gearbeitet habe gabs für den sql befehl das schicke anhängsel "... LIMIT <wert> ..." wenn ich das aber in Access über den SQL Editor anhänge sagt er mir das ein Syntaxfehler besteht.

Das Funktioniert ... aber ohne die Eingrenzung auf 10 Einträge.

Code:
SELECT wochenreporting.Werbefläche, wochenreporting.[Leads / Anzahl] AS Leads, wochenreporting.Kw, wochenreporting.Jahr
FROM wochenreporting
ORDER BY wochenreporting.[Leads / Anzahl] DESC;



Das Funktioniert nicht ...

Code:
SELECT wochenreporting.Werbefläche, wochenreporting.[Leads / Anzahl] AS Leads, wochenreporting.Kw, wochenreporting.Jahr
FROM wochenreporting
ORDER BY wochenreporting.[Leads / Anzahl] DESC LIMIT 10;



Weiß jemand wie man das lösen kann in der abfrage?
--
Beuschen Sie
www.heiko-seifert.net
www.xn--wlfe-im-exil-4ib.de

Dieser Post wurde am 06.05.2008 um 16:18 Uhr von Heiko editiert.
 
Profil || Private Message || Suche Download || Zitatantwort || Editieren || Löschen || IP
001
06.05.2008, 16:35 Uhr
Heiko



hab das problem gelöst

statt des "LIMIT <wert>" muss man in Access nach dem SELECT noch "TOP <wert>" angeben also folgendermaßen:


Code:
SELECT TOP 10 wochenreporting.Werbefläche, wochenreporting.[Leads / Anzahl] AS Leads, wochenreporting.Kw, wochenreporting.Jahr
FROM wochenreporting
ORDER BY wochenreporting.[Leads / Anzahl] DESC;



Zum Beispiel
--
Beuschen Sie
www.heiko-seifert.net
www.xn--wlfe-im-exil-4ib.de
 
Profil || Private Message || Suche Download || Zitatantwort || Editieren || Löschen || IP
002
06.05.2008, 18:12 Uhr
Guybrush Threepwood
Gefürchteter Pirat
(Operator)


 
Profil || Private Message || Suche Download || Zitatantwort || Editieren || Löschen || IP
003
06.05.2008, 18:47 Uhr
öni




Code:
SELECT TOP 10 Werbefläche, [Leads / Anzahl] AS Leads, Kw, Jahr
FROM wochenreporting
ORDER BY wochenreporting.[Leads / Anzahl] DESC;


Wäre der select teil nicht so ein wenig übersichtlicher?, wenn du nur eine tabelle hast kannst dir das mit dem Punkt ja sparen!

Dieser Post wurde am 06.05.2008 um 18:47 Uhr von öni editiert.
 
Profil || Private Message || Suche Download || Zitatantwort || Editieren || Löschen || IP
Seiten: > 1 <     [ Software ]  


ThWBoard 2.73 FloSoft-Edition
© by Paul Baecher & Felix Gonschorek (www.thwboard.de)

Anpassungen des Forums
© by Flo-Soft (www.flo-soft.de)

Sie sind Besucher: